An ideal gas heat engine operates in a Carnot cycle between 227°C and, 127°C. It absorbs 6 k cal at the higher temperature. The amount of heat (in k cal) converted into work is equal to

(a) 4.8

(b) 3.5

(c) 1.6

(d) 1.2
